The dramatic effects of brain damage can provide some of the most interesting insights into the nature of normal cognitive performance. In recent years a number of neuropsychological studies have reported a particular form of cognitive impairment where patients have problems recognising objects from one category but remain able to recognise those from others. The most frequent ‘category-specific’ pattern is an impairment identifying living things, compared to nonliving things. The reverse pattern of dissociation, i.e., an impairment recognising and naming nonliving things relative to living things, has been reported albeit much less frequently. The objective of the work carried out in this thesis was to investigate the organising principles and anatomical correlates of stored knowledge for categories of living and nonliving things. Three complementary cognitive neuropsychological research techniques were employed to assess how, and where, this knowledge is represented in the brain: (i) studies of normal (neurologically intact) subjects, (ii) case-studies of neurologically impaired patients with selective deficits in object recognition, and (iii) studies of the anatomical correlates of stored knowledge for living and nonliving things on the brain using magnetoencephalography (MEG). The main empirical findings showed that semantic knowledge about living and nonliving things is principally encoded in terms of sensory and functional features, respectively. In two case-study chapters evidence was found supporting the view that category-specific impairments can arise from damage to a pre-semantic system, rather than the assumption often made that the system involved must be semantic. In the MEG study, rather than finding evidence for the involvement of specific brain areas for different object categories, it appeared that, when subjects named and categorised living and nonliving things, a non-differentiated neural system was involved.

We examined whether inductive reasoning development is better characterized by accounts assuming an early category bias versus an early perceptual bias. We trained 264 children aged 3 to 9 years to categorize novel insects using a rule that directly pitted category membership against appearance. This was followed by an induction task with perceptual distractors at different levels of featural similarity. An additional 52 children were given the same training followed by an induction task with alternative stimuli. Categorization performance was consistently high, however we found a gradual transition from a perceptual bias in our youngest children to a category bias around age 6-7. In addition, children of all ages were equally distracted by higher levels of featural similarity. The transition is unlikely to be due to an increased ability to inhibit perceptual distractors. Instead, we argue that the transition is driven by a fundamental change in children’s understanding of category membership.

Do promotions in a certain category lead to higher revenues in other categories? If so, to what degree? The answers to these questions are highly relevant for retailers that supply products in different categories. Empirical findings in studies that consider a limited number of categories indicate small promotional cross-category effects. This study develops a framework to determine the impact of price promotions on category revenues that include interdependencies among a substantial number of categories at the category demand level. The own- and cross-category demand effects are moderated by variables such as promotion intensity, category characteristics (own-category effects), and spatial distances between shelf locations (cross-category effects). The empirical results based on daily store-level scanner data show that approximately half of all price promotions expand own-category revenues, especially for categories with deeper supported discounts. There is a high probability (61%) that a price promotion affects sales of at least one other category. The number of categories affected is not greater than two. Moderate evidence supports the existence of cross-promotional effects between categories more closely located in a store.

Extant research on the decomposition of unit sales bumps due to price promotions considers these effects only within a single product category. This article introduces a framework that accommodates specific cross-category effects. Empirical results based on daily data measured at the item/SKU level show that the effects of promotions on sales in other categories are modest. Between-category complementary effects (20%) are, on average, substantially larger than between-category substitution effects (11%). Hence, a promotion of an item has an average net spin-off effect of (20 - 11 =) 9% of its own effect. The number of significant cross-category effects is low, which means that we expect that, most of the time, it is sufficient to look at within-category effects only. We also find within-category complementary effects, which implies that competitive items within the category may benefit from a promotion. We find small stockpiling effects (6%), modest cross-item effects (22%), and substantial category-expansion effects (72%). The cross-item effects are the result of cross-item substitution effects within the category (26%) and within-category complementary effects (4%). Approximately 15% (= 11% / 72%) of the category-expansion effect is due to between-category substitution effects of dependent categories.

Context traditionally has been regarded in vision research as a determinant for the interpretation of sensory information on the basis of previously acquired knowledge. Here we propose a novel, complementary perspective by showing that context also specifically affects visual category learning. In two experiments involving sets of Compound Gabor patterns we explored how context, as given by the stimulus set to be learned, affects the internal representation of pattern categories. In Experiment 1, we changed the (local) context of the individual signal classes by changing the configuration of the learning set. In Experiment 2, we varied the (global) context of a fixed class configuration by changing the degree of signal accentuation. Generalization performance was assessed in terms of the ability to recognize contrast-inverted versions of the learning patterns. Both contextual variations yielded distinct effects on learning and generalization thus indicating a change in internal category representation. Computer simulations suggest that the latter is related to changes in the set of attributes underlying the production rules of the categories. The implications of these findings for phenomena of contrast (in)variance in visual perception are discussed.

Inductive reasoning is fundamental to human cognition, yet it remains unclear how we develop this ability and what might influence our inductive choices. We created novel categories in which crucial factors such as domain and category structure were manipulated orthogonally. We trained 403 4-9-year-old children to categorise well-matched natural kind and artefact stimuli with either featural or relational category structure, followed by induction tasks. This wide age range allowed for the first full exploration of the developmental trajectory of inductive reasoning in both domains. We found a gradual transition from perceptual to categorical induction with age. This pattern was stable across domains, but interestingly, children showed a category bias one year later for relational categories. We hypothesise that the ability to use category information in inductive reasoning develops gradually, but is delayed when children need to process and apply more complex category structures. © 2014 © 2014 Taylor & Francis.

In three experiments we investigated the impact that exposure to counter-stereotypes has on emotional reactions to outgroups. In Experiment 1, thinking about gender counter-stereotypes attenuated stereotyped emotions toward females and males. In Experiment 2, an immigrant counterstereotype attenuated stereotyped emotions toward this outgroup and reduced dehumanization tendencies. Experiment 3 replicated these results using an alternative measure of humanization. In both Experiments 2 and 3 sequential meditational analysis revealed that counter-stereotypes produced feelings of surprise which, in turn, elicited a cognitive process of expectancy violation which resulted in attenuated stereotyped emotions and an enhanced use of uniquely human characteristics to describe the outgroup. The findings extend research supporting the usefulness of counter-stereotype exposure for reducing prejudice and highlight its positive impact on intergroup emotions.

Partially comparative pricing involves a featured store providing price comparisons in reference to a competitor for some products (comparatively priced products) while omitting such comparisons and providing only its price for other products (non-comparatively priced products). Barone, Manning and Miniard (2004) found that while partially comparative pricing enhanced consumers' price perceptions of comparatively priced products at the featured retailer, it had the opposite effect for non-comparatively priced products (i.e., an inferiority effect). To the contrary, it is argued that a price comparison for one brand in a product category may enhance consumers' price perceptions of the remaining, non-comparatively priced brands within the same product category (i.e., a superiority effect). This research seeks to (a) examine the robustness of partially comparative pricing's effect in an across-product category context compared to a within-product category context and (b) extend the understanding of partially comparative pricing's within-product category effect on non-comparatively priced brands by examining potential moderators of this effect: brand diversity, brand typicality, and the relative expensiveness of the brand receiving the price comparison. The findings of four studies provide evidence to support the presence of a superiority effect in a within-product category context and suggests that the adverse effect of partially comparative pricing in an across-product category context may not be as robust as previously thought. Although the superiority effect was unaffected by brand diversity (i.e., whether the brands emanated from different manufacturers or from a single manufacturer), it was found to be moderated by the typicality of the brand receiving the price comparison as well as the comparison brand's relative expensiveness. Research participants formed more favorable relative price beliefs about the non-comparatively priced brand when the comparatively priced brand was perceived as a more typical member of the product category. Similarly, participants formed more favorable beliefs about the non-comparatively priced brand when the comparison price was assigned to the most expensive brand in the product category rather than the least expensive brand.

Category hierarchy is an abstraction mechanism for efficiently managing large-scale resources. In an open environment, a category hierarchy will inevitably become inappropriate for managing resources that constantly change with unpredictable pattern. An inappropriate category hierarchy will mislead the management of resources. The increasing dynamicity and scale of online resources increase the requirement of automatically maintaining category hierarchy. Previous studies about category hierarchy mainly focus on either the generation of category hierarchy or the classification of resources under a pre-defined category hierarchy. The automatic maintenance of category hierarchy has been neglected. Making abstraction among categories and measuring the similarity between categories are two basic behaviours to generate a category hierarchy. Humans are good at making abstraction but limited in ability to calculate the similarities between large-scale resources. Computing models are good at calculating the similarities between large-scale resources but limited in ability to make abstraction. To take both advantages of human view and computing ability, this paper proposes a two-phase approach to automatically maintaining category hierarchy within two scales by detecting the internal pattern change of categories. The global phase clusters resources to generate a reference category hierarchy and gets similarity between categories to detect inappropriate categories in the initial category hierarchy. The accuracy of the clustering approaches in generating category hierarchy determines the rationality of the global maintenance. The local phase detects topical changes and then adjusts inappropriate categories with three local operations. The global phase can quickly target inappropriate categories top-down and carry out cross-branch adjustment, which can also accelerate the local-phase adjustments. The local phase detects and adjusts the local-range inappropriate categories that are not adjusted in the global phase. By incorporating the two complementary phase adjustments, the approach can significantly improve the topical cohesion and accuracy of category hierarchy. A new measure is proposed for evaluating category hierarchy considering not only the balance of the hierarchical structure but also the accuracy of classification. Experiments show that the proposed approach is feasible and effective to adjust inappropriate category hierarchy. The proposed approach can be used to maintain the category hierarchy for managing various resources in dynamic application environment. It also provides an approach to specialize the current online category hierarchy to organize resources with more specific categories.

Default invariance is the idea that default does not change at any scale of law and finance. Default is a conserved quantity in a universe where fundamental principles of law and finance operate. It exists at the micro-level as part of the fundamental structure of every financial transaction, and at the macro- level, as a fixed critical point within the relatively stable phases of the law and finance cycle. A key point is that default is equivalent to maximizing uncertainty at the micro-level and at the macro-level, is equivalent to the phase transition where unbearable fluctuations occur in all forms of risk transformation, including maturity, liquidity and credit. As such, default invariance is the glue that links the micro and macro structures of law and finance. In this essay, we apply naïve category theory (NCT), a type of mapping logic, to these types of phenomena. The purpose of using NCT is to introduce a rigorous (but simple) mathematical methodology to law and finance discourse and to show that these types of structural considerations are of prime practical importance and significance to law and finance practitioners. These mappings imply a number of novel areas of investigation. From the micro- structure, three macro-approximations are implied. These approximations form the core analytical framework which we will use to examine the phenomena and hypothesize rules governing law and finance. Our observations from these approximations are grouped into five findings. While the entirety of the five findings can be encapsulated by the three approximations, since the intended audience of this paper is the non-specialist in law, finance and category theory, for ease of access we will illustrate the use of the mappings with relatively common concepts drawn from law and finance, focusing especially on financial contracts, derivatives, Shadow Banking, credit rating agencies and credit crises.

The paper problematises the category of noncitizenship. It traces its trajectory in accounts of inclusive citizenship and argues that it is difficult to theorise it as a distinct theoretical category outside of citizenship. To support this argument, the paper distinguishes between a pluralist, political and democratic variant of accounts of inclusive citizenship and it shows how they all end up reducing noncitizenship to a journey to citizenship. To overcome this limit, the paper develops the idea of subversive politicisation and suggests that injustices and inequalities can be challenged without falling back on the vocabulary of citizenship.

The literature shows that category management is an important concept and tool for retailers and suppliers, but that there is a trend to move to a more shopper-centric category management approach, linked to the shoppermarketing approach. However, the knowledge on this issue is scarce on some retailing sectors, like convenience stores. The present study is focused on convenience stores, with the main purpose of finding out to what extent non-major food retailers successfully adopt a shopper-centric category management. The study is relevant in order to evaluate if a more shopper-centric approach is adequate to smaller companies/stores. To accomplish that goal, an exploratory qualitative study was conducted among convenience store retailers and suppliers. Six semistructured face-to-face interviews were conducted with Commercial Directors and Trade Marketing Managers. This data was complemented with thirteen interviews with shopper marketing experts. The data was analyzed using thematic content analysis technique, identifying themes, categories, subcategories, units of meaning and relations. The results revealed that convenience store retailers use some of the principles and techniques of the shopper-marketing and shopper-centric category management approaches, which they do in a non-standardized and non-formal approach or process. Their suppliers (the manufacturers) do it in a more formal and structured manner, probably as a result of previous interaction with major supermarkets chains. Both direct and indirect evidences of a shopper-centric approach were found, which, however, were slight, discrete and not formal.

The aim of the study was to develop a culturally adapted translation of the 12-item smell identification test from Sniffin' Sticks (SS-12) for the Estonian population in order to help diagnose Parkinson's disease (PD). A standard translation of the SS-12 was created and 150 healthy Estonians were questioned about the smells used as response options in the test. Unfamiliar smells were replaced by culturally familiar options. The adapted SS-12 was applied to 70 controls in all age groups, and thereafter to 50 PD patients and 50 age- and sex-matched controls. 14 response options from 48 used in the SS-12 were replaced with familiar smells in an adapted version, in which the mean rate of correct response was 87% (range 73-99) compared to 83% with the literal translation (range 50-98). In PD patients, the average adapted SS-12 score (5.4/12) was significantly lower than in controls (average score 8.9/12), p < 0.0001. A multiple linear regression using the score in the SS-12 as the outcome measure showed that diagnosis and age independently influenced the result of the SS-12. A logistic regression using the SS-12 and age as covariates showed that the SS-12 (but not age) correctly classified 79.0% of subjects into the PD and control category, using a cut-off of <7 gave a sensitivity of 76% and specificity of 86% for the diagnosis of PD. The developed SS-12 cultural adaption is appropriate for testing olfaction in Estonia for the purpose of PD diagnosis.
